Abstract

The practice of anchoring roofs with anchors is based mainly on an empirical approach - the trial and error method. The theory of anchoring is more descriptive than mathematical. Due to the complexity of geological, mining and technical conditions of underground workings, it is very difficult to describe mathematically the destruction of the roof of the workings reinforced with anchors. Nevertheless, even qualitative identification of the factors causing the destruction of the edge parts of the coal seam and, as a consequence, the roof collapse, can provide justification for the development of the anchoring passport and safety improvement.
